Current Battlefield Situation and Military Actions
The battlefield is constantly shifting. One of the most critical aspects of the Russia-Ukraine war to understand is the current battlefield situation. Recent reports indicate intense fighting in several key areas. For instance, the eastern front around Bakhmut has seen some of the most brutal clashes. Both sides are digging in, fortifying their positions, and launching offensives. Russian forces have been focusing on consolidating their gains in the Donbas region, while Ukrainian forces are fighting to reclaim lost territories. Ukraine is receiving military aid from Western countries, which has been crucial in bolstering its defense capabilities. The aid includes advanced weaponry, such as artillery, tanks, and air defense systems. However, the supply chain and delivery of this aid are complex, and the impact is not always immediate. Military analysts are closely watching these developments, assessing the strategies and capabilities of both sides. In addition to ground battles, aerial operations are playing a significant role. Both sides are using drones and air strikes to target military positions and infrastructure. These operations contribute to the destruction and create challenges for civilians. Diplomatic Efforts and International Response
The international response to the Russia-Ukraine war is very important. Diplomatic efforts, though often challenging, remain a crucial part of the process. Several countries and international organizations are involved in trying to find a peaceful resolution. The United Nations and other international bodies are at the forefront of these efforts. They are working to facilitate negotiations and address humanitarian needs. The international community is deeply concerned about the war's impact on civilians. The sanctions imposed on Russia are a key part of the international response. These measures are designed to pressure Russia to end its military operations and withdraw its forces. However, the impact of these sanctions is a subject of debate. Some observers say the sanctions are not strong enough to halt the war. Other observers point to their effect on the Russian economy and its ability to fund the war effort. Humanitarian aid is another critical element of the response. Many organizations are providing assistance to those affected by the war, including refugees and internally displaced persons. The scale of the humanitarian crisis is immense, and the need for aid remains significant. International support and condemnation of Russia have been very strong. Various countries have expressed their support for Ukraine, providing both military and financial assistance. These measures show a united front against the aggression. Economic and Humanitarian Impacts
The economic and humanitarian impacts of the Russia-Ukraine war are significant. The conflict has had a devastating impact on the Ukrainian economy. Many businesses have closed, and economic activity has plummeted. The destruction of infrastructure and the disruption of supply chains have further exacerbated the economic challenges. The war has also had a major impact on global markets. Rising energy prices, food shortages, and inflation are some of the most visible effects. Ukraine is a major exporter of grain, and the war has disrupted these exports. This has led to higher food prices worldwide. The humanitarian crisis is particularly dire. Millions of Ukrainians have been displaced from their homes, and many have become refugees. The need for humanitarian aid, including food, shelter, and medical care, is enormous. Humanitarian organizations are working tirelessly to provide assistance, but the scale of the need exceeds the available resources. The war has created challenges for those who remain in Ukraine. Many people have lost their homes and livelihoods. Access to essential services, such as healthcare and education, has been disrupted. The war's impact on human lives is tragic and far-reaching. Key Players and Their Strategies
Let's talk about the key players and their strategies in the Russia-Ukraine war. Russia's primary objective is to achieve its strategic goals, including the control of certain territories and the weakening of Ukraine's ties with the West. Moscow has used various strategies, including military offensives, information warfare, and economic pressure. Russia's military strategy has been characterized by both conventional and unconventional tactics. Ukraine, with the support of its allies, has been focusing on defending its territory and repelling Russian forces. Kyiv's strategy involves the use of innovative tactics and the strategic deployment of its forces. The United States and other Western countries play a crucial role. They are providing military and financial aid to Ukraine, imposing sanctions on Russia, and working to isolate Moscow diplomatically. This collective support has significantly strengthened Ukraine's defense capabilities. NATO, the North Atlantic Treaty Organization, is playing a critical role in the war. The alliance has increased its presence in Eastern Europe and is providing support to Ukraine. China, as a major global power, has taken a more nuanced approach. While not directly involved in the conflict, China has expressed its concerns and called for dialogue. China's economic and political interests in the region make its stance and actions important.
